Why Interim Management Is Strategically Important Today
The interim management market is growing rapidly. According to the DDIM Market Study 2024, the German market volume is around €2.9 billion — an increase of 10% compared to the previous year. Executives for transformation, digitalisation, and change management are particularly in demand (DDIM, 2024 – in German available only).
Internationally, the trend is similar. The EO Executives Interim Management Report 2025 shows that interim managers are increasingly deployed in growth and innovation projects, no longer only in crisis situations. Nearly 70% of companies use interim management specifically for strategic transformation processes (EO Executives, 2025).

Interim Managers as the Bridge Between Strategy and Execution
Many organisations have a clear agenda: digitalisation, efficiency, new leadership models. Yet once a key role remains unfilled, even the best strategy slows down.
Interim leaders close this gap.
They integrate into existing structures within days, assume both operational and strategic responsibility, and keep projects on course.
The DDIM 2024 Study shows: over 90% of interim managers reach full effectiveness within two weeks. The average assignment lasts eight to twelve months, and client satisfaction exceeds 95%.
